The primary source of outrage stems from Ubisoft fulfilling longstanding fan requests to set an Assassin's Creed game in Japan. Fans had eagerly been urging for a Japanese-themed installment for years, and many were excited about this new chapter. However, the excitement quickly soured due to the portrayal of the game's protagonist, Yasak, who is depicted as a Black man—contradicting historical expectations and upsetting many traditionalist fans.
